How the comment-to-course workflow works
The follower comments the keyword (WAITLIST, CLASS, or BONUS), the creator sends the waitlist or enrollment link, the follower registers, and the course platform records them. GramTrigger organizes the campaign record with the keyword, destination link, fulfillment script, and lead count.
Setting up the course destination
The destination link should point to a waitlist page, webinar registration, or enrollment page. Confirm the page is live and tested. Save the confirmed link in the GramTrigger campaign record before the post goes live.
Writing the fulfillment script
The script should direct the follower to the course destination. Placeholder example: "You are on the early access list! Here is where to hold your spot: [link]." Save the script in the campaign record for consistent fulfillment.
Tracking course leads
GramTrigger tracks the lead count for each campaign. The course platform tracks registrations. Comparing these numbers shows how many comment requests converted to course leads.
